Transaction 3287e882f3181a8e57bbcba43d2206014866376572b92ff742a331ea3d51b51b

4 Input
2 Outputs
  • 3287e882f3181a8e57bbcba43d2206014866376572b92ff742a331ea3d51b51b:0
  • value  50000000
    address  34EmqvtQkFJdsFetCZwjf45YJcwqEKagVT
  • 3287e882f3181a8e57bbcba43d2206014866376572b92ff742a331ea3d51b51b:1
  • value  3166408
    address  38VPbeLpr8jEq7PKk5TTP9m8XHrnG78hW8